UIGEA to be debated in US Congress - Online Bingo News

April 1, 2008

Online bingo industry and online gaming industry observers will be taking particular note of the latest US Congressional hearing on the practical implementation of the Unlawful Internet Gambling Act (UIGEA) this April 2.

The international online bingo games industry was hit very badly by the arrival of UIGEA in late 2006 with many online bingo halls having to exit the US market to avoid legal issues with US authorities.  UIGEA seeks to disrupt the financial transactions between online gaming operators and US-based customers.

The April 2 Congressional hearing, titled "Proposed UIGEA Regulations: Burden Without Benefit?" is regarded as being a critically important chance by the online gaming industry to engage in thorough debate over UIGEA.
